Skip to main content
Logo image

Unit 2 Selection and Iteration

This unit introduces selection (if statements) and iteration (loops) in Java.
  • AP Exam Weighting: 25–35%
  • Class Periods: ~29-31
  • Time Estimate: 90 minutes per most lessons except 45 minutes for 2.1, 2.2, and 2.12. At least 10 class periods for review, practice, FRQs, labs, and progress checks.
  • AP Classroom Progress Check Unit 2 Part 1: Topics 2.1–2.6, Multiple-choice: ~18 questions, Free-response: 1 question, Methods and Control Structures (partial)
  • AP Classroom Progress Check Unit 2 Part 2: Topics 2.7–2.12,Multiple-choice: ~21 questions, Free-response: 2 question, Methods and Control Structures (partial)